Output 13bfd01630f89254f8f7ace36de5eb5052d90ce7541a0a61b935c8d7338b046a:0

value
674700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804a972b789a1e72e0f366c735b62ddd7b26c61a OP_EQUAL
address
3DPMmjieoyhE8MF1rgy8PKmaZUDncjJXkq
transaction
13bfd01630f89254f8f7ace36de5eb5052d90ce7541a0a61b935c8d7338b046a
spent
true